msauth

Introduction

Very simple package to authorize applications against Microsoft identity platform.

It utilizes v2.0 endpoint so that it can authorize users using both personal (Microsoft) and organizational (Azure AD) account.

Usage

Device authorization grant

const (
	tenantID     = "XXXXXX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XXXXXXXXXX"
	clientID     = "YYYYYY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YYYYYYYYYY"
	tokenCachePath  = "token_cache.json"
)

var scopes = []string{"openid", "profile", "offline_access", "User.Read", "Files.Read"}

	ctx := context.Background()
	m := msauth.NewManager()
	m.LoadFile(tokenCachePath)
	ts, err := m.DeviceAuthorizationGrant(ctx, tenantID, clientID, scopes, nil)
	if err != nil {
		log.Fatal(err)
	}
	m.SaveFile(tokenCachePath)

	httpClient := oauth2.NewClient(ctx, ts)
	...

Client credentials grant

const (
	tenantID     = "XXXXXX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XXXXXXXXXX"
	clientID     = "YYYYYY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YYYYYYYYYY"
	clientSecret = "Z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Z"
)

var scopes = []string{msauth.DefaultMSGraphScope}

	ctx := context.Background()
	m := msauth.NewManager()
	ts, err := m.ClientCredentialsGrant(ctx, tenantID, clientID, clientSecret, scopes)
	if err != nil {
		log.Fatal(err)
	}

	httpClient := oauth2.NewClient(ctx, ts)
    ...

Resource owner password credentials grant

const (
	tenantID     = "XXXXXX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XXXXXXXXXX"
	clientID     = "YYYYYY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YY-YYYYYYYYYYYY"
	clientSecret = "Z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Z"
	username     = "[email protected]"
	password     = "secure-password"
)

var scopes = []string{msauth.DefaultMSGraphScope}

	ctx := context.Background()
	m := msauth.NewManager()
	ts, err := m.ResourceOwnerPasswordGrant(ctx, tenantID, clientID, clientSecret, username, password, scopes)
	if err != nil {
		log.Fatal(err)
	}

	httpClient := oauth2.NewClient(ctx, ts)
    ...

# Functions

CacheKey generates a token cache key from tenantID/clientID.
NewManager returns a new Manager instance.
ReadLocation reads data from file with path or URL.
WriteLocation writes data to file with path or URL.

# Constants

DefaultMSGraphScope is the default scope for MS Graph API.

# Structs

DeviceCode is returned on device auth initiation.
Manager is oauth2 token cache manager.
TokenError is returned on failed authentication.
